Skip to content

Commit 194d68d

Browse files
imirkinBen Skeggs
authored andcommitted
drm/nouveau/bsp/g92: disable by default
G92's seem to require some additional bit of initialization before the BSP engine can work. It feels like clocks are not set up for the underlying VLD engine, which means that all commands submitted to the xtensa chip end up hanging. VP seems to work fine though. This still allows people to force-enable the bsp engine if they want to play around with it, but makes it harder for the card to hang by default. Signed-off-by: Ilia Mirkin <imirkin@alum.mit.edu> Signed-off-by: Ben Skeggs <bskeggs@redhat.com> Cc: stable@vger.kernel.org
1 parent 77913bb commit 194d68d

1 file changed

Lines changed: 1 addition & 1 deletion

File tree

  • drivers/gpu/drm/nouveau/nvkm/engine/bsp

drivers/gpu/drm/nouveau/nvkm/engine/bsp/g84.c

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-39,5 +39,5 @@ int
3939
g84_bsp_new(struct nvkm_device *device, int index, struct nvkm_engine **pengine)
4040
{
4141
return nvkm_xtensa_new_(&g84_bsp, device, index,
42-
true, 0x103000, pengine);
42+
device->chipset != 0x92, 0x103000, pengine);
4343
}

0 commit comments

Comments
 (0)